About H. Katinger
H. Katinger is a scholar working on Molecular Biology, Plant Science, Biotechnology, Virology and Biomedical Engineering, having authored 80 papers that have together received 4.7k indexed citations. Recurring topics across this work include Viral Infectious Diseases and Gene Expression in Insects (21 papers), Plant Virus Research Studies (13 papers), Transgenic Plants and Applications (12 papers), HIV Research and Treatment (10 papers), Protein purification and stability (9 papers), Plant tissue culture and regeneration (9 papers), Monoclonal and Polyclonal Antibodies Research (8 papers) and Microbial Metabolic Engineering and Bioproduction (8 papers). The work is most often cited by research in Virology (2.7k citations), Immunology (1.5k citations), Infectious Diseases (989 citations), Radiology, Nuclear Medicine and Imaging (1.1k citations) and Biotechnology (396 citations). H. Katinger has collaborated with scholars based in Austria, Pakistan and United States. Frequent co-authors include Alexandra Trkola, Martin Purtscher, Thomas Muster, Franz Steindl, Gottfried Himmler, A. Klima, Florian Rüker, Andrea Buchacher, John P. Moore and Joseph Sodroski. Their work appears in journals such as Journal of Virology, Nucleic Acids Research, Journal of General Virology, Biotechnology Progress and Cellular and Molecular Life Sciences.
